Ticket PEDL-442: Staging misconfiguration for SpokeShift rebalancer

Welcome aboard. The staging instance of SpokeShift, our bike-share rebalancing tool for the Varnholt dock network, is pointing at the production depot queue because the staging env file was copied incorrectly. Please recreate the file from the template, confirm DEPOT_QUEUE_URL references staging, and verify the worker reconnects. The staging env file must end with the following line.

secret setting of baduf-fahag: LEDGER_TOKEN8=35e35511

### Step 4: Connection Pooling

Before migrating the Orchardline billing service, new team members must understand that the legacy pool opened one connection per request, which overwhelmed the Tressa database during month-end runs. The new pooler reuses connections and caps concurrency per worker. Verify your local settings match the shared profile before running the migration script. The required pool configuration is shown below.

deployment values, yadug-bawif:
[framir]
team = pelox
access_code = ac_a38ab2
owner = tamion.julael
host = framir.tolvaqlabs.test
port = 11211
peer = tammir.zemvargrid.local
salt = 2215ef03
pin = 1541

## Replica Lag Alarm — quick notes

Hey, new release manager! The Quillbase read-replica lag alarm fires when lag exceeds 30 seconds. Usually it's a big analytics batch — check with the Tundrel team first. If you need to push the hotfix config to silence false positives, sign it with the deploy key below:

rollout seal: bky4_x7Gc